From Strangers to Friends
The other day I took my fixed gear bike out for a ride to the Environmental Learning center.
It's a nice ride - you go past a lot of parks and water follows you the whole way along the bike trail.
The "fixie" I rode was purchased a year ago on Craigslist, and from what I can tell, it pretty much is assembled out of used parts dating back to the early 1970s. Why not? I had told myself, when the time came to purchase this bike.
So there I am, about 7 miles from home, cruising along, when my left crank starts to wobble. Uh oh, I'm thinking.
Nothing worse than being caught a long way from home with a broken bike. Oh, and I forgot to mention - there were dark rain clouds building up too.
Sure enough, the crank falls off, and there I am caught on the side of the trail, examining the situation.
Not sure if you've ever ridden a fixed gear bike. They're weird. You can't stop pedaling and coast. You just have to crank and crank and crank.
Oddly enough, this was a good thing for my situation! I ended up looking a little strange, as I rode past a group of 20 or so kids, pumping away with my right leg, and letting my left leg dangle.
Well, after a couple of miles of this, I grew tired and decided to walk.
I went through an alley, past some backyard gardens, and came out in front of a house where an insurance guy was finishing a sales call.
"Hey, do you need a ride?" He called out.
I looked over, and he drove a Subaru Forester with a bike rack on top. My kind of guy.
"I don't need one, but I'll take one!"
So this nice gentleman, Bob Smith, of all names, became my new best friend.
He drove me to the bike shop, they fixed me up, and I was on my way.
Moral of the story: You never know when a stranger will become your friend.
